Transaction 1c33f367f8df75286c5a233b3390c1cbb367d43ede2d32119f657eddf171c9f2
1 Input
1 Output
-
1c33f367f8df75286c5a233b3390c1cbb367d43ede2d32119f657eddf171c9f2:0
- value
- 323130589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a0d36854b750ec47b5fb346ecf83e35a50539e9 OP_EQUAL
- address
- 3BMmNvxZgaf8YADsFqt1bxPjDtb38PRsSM